Handover: Canary gating on Brightmast

Welcome aboard. Before you touch the Brightmast deploy pipeline, read this carefully. Canary promotion is gated on three signals: error rate under the rolling threshold, p95 latency within bounds, and a minimum soak time of twenty minutes. Do not override the soak timer manually — Priya tried once and we rolled back for a day. The gate evaluator runs in the Larkfield cluster and reads its thresholds at startup only, so restarts are required after edits. The current gating configuration is as follows.

settings of fajop-fahap:
[holeth]
port = 9300
team = juleth
host = holeth.tolvaqsoft.example
region = south-4
access_code = ac_4bcdf6
timeout_ms = 500

Subject: Key rotation for InvoiceForge renderer

Welcome, new folks. Every quarter we rotate the credential the Pellworth PDF invoice renderer uses to call our internal asset service, Vaultline. The old key stops working Friday at noon. Update your local .env and the staging config before then, and verify a test invoice renders with the new embedded fonts. For convenience, the freshly issued key is included here.

app token of bagef-bageg = kto11_vuwA0uhrEMg

# Chipgate Reader — Environments

Chipgate ingests timing-chip reads at marathon mats and forwards split times to the results service. We run three environments: dev (simulated mat traffic), staging (replayed reads from the Harrowfield Half), and prod. Staging is the only environment wired to the replay harness, so calibration changes should land there first. For this week's sync, note that staging currently runs with these configuration values.

config for kafof-bawef:
holath:
  log_level: debug
  metrics_host: metrics.holath.qorvelsys.internal
  pin: 2191
  pool_size: 32

## Further Reading

If you're on call for the ParcelPulse webhook, please read this section before touching anything. The webhook delivers carrier scan events from the Mistral relay, and retries use exponential backoff with a hard cap of six attempts; after that, events land in the dead-letter queue and must be replayed manually. Signature validation failures are almost always clock skew on the Oakhaven gateway. The detailed replay procedure, payload schemas, and failure modes are documented on our internal wiki page:

operations page: https://jenkins.zemvarcloud.local/job/merge_requests/repo/build/73930b4b30f0a8ed